Transaction 876fac955e3c40bd217985c8d66c9296b36fb0436a7e4785cd57afba82454d60
1 Input
1 Output
-
876fac955e3c40bd217985c8d66c9296b36fb0436a7e4785cd57afba82454d60:0
- value
- 74712963
- script pubkey
- OP_0 OP_PUSHBYTES_20 e08d50a0b9bafd9180a600755ba51c2e54a6068d
- address
- bc1quzx4pg9eht7erq9xqp64hfgu9e22vp5d3clq4y